Hue Truong Tien Bridge (Source: Internet)U.S. Embassy contact in Hue directs to the Embassy in Hanoi or Consulate in Ho Chi Minh City, as no dedicated office exists in Hue (per 2025 U.S. State Department). Act fast for issues like lost passports. Here’s a guide based on consular data:
Emergency Contacts:
U.S. Embassy Hanoi: Address: 7 Lang Ha Street, Ba Dinh District, Hanoi. Phone: +84 24 3850 5000 (general); Emergency: +84 24 3850 5000 (after hours). Email: ACSHanoi@state.gov.
U.S. Consulate Ho Chi Minh City: Address: 4 Le Duan Street, District 1, Ho Chi Minh City. Phone: +84 28 3520 4200 (general); Emergency: +84 28 3520 4200. Email: ACSHCMC@state.gov.
For Hue: Local police first (113), then embassy (nearest Hanoi ~600km).
Lost Passport Procedures:
Report to Police: Nearest station, e.g., Phu Hoa Police in Phu Hoa Ward; get report (free, 1–2 hours).
Contact Embassy: Call for guidance; apply for emergency passport (valid for return).
Documents: Police report, photos (2, $5 or 125,000 VND), form DS-11/DS-64 (free download), proof of citizenship.
Time: Emergency 1–3 days; full 4–6 weeks.
Cost: Emergency $145 (3,625,000 VND); full $165 (4,125,000 VND); Vietnam exit visa $30 (750,000 VND).

Hue City, with Phu Bai Airport 15 km from Phu Hoa Ward, is accessible via:
By Air: Fly to Phu Bai from Hanoi or Ho Chi Minh City ($30–$80 or 750,000–2,000,000 VND, 1–1.5 hours). Airport to city: private car $10–$15 (250,000–375,000 VND, 20 minutes) or Xanh SM taxi $8–$12 (200,000–300,000 VND).
By Train: Reunification Express from Hanoi (12–14 hours, $20–$40 or 500,000–1,000,000 VND) or Ho Chi Minh City (18–22 hours, $30–$60 or 750,000–1,500,000 VND) to Hue Station, 2 km from Phu Hoa Ward.
By Bus: From Hanoi (12–14 hours, $15–$25 or 375,000–625,000 VND) or Ho Chi Minh City (20–24 hours, $20–$35 or 500,000–875,000 VND) to Hue’s central bus station, 4 km from Phu Hoa Ward.
By Private Car: From Da Nang (2 hours, $40–$60 or 1,000,000–1,500,000 VND). Book via Legend Travel Group.
By Bicycle (Local): Rent in Phu Hoa Ward ($2–$4/day) for short trips. Navigation Tip: Save “Imperial City, Phu Hoa, Hue City” in offline maps (Maps.me). Parking: $0.50–$1 (12,500–25,000 VND).
